Introduction
In the rapidly evolving world of technology, the Certified Tester Advanced Level Test Automation Engineer (CTAL-TAE) certification is increasingly recognized across Asia as a benchmark for excellence in software testing and automation. As businesses strive for operational efficiency and innovation, the demand for skilled test automation engineers has surged. This course is designed to prepare professionals for the CTAL-TAE certification, equipping them with the skills and knowledge necessary to excel in the competitive landscape of Asia’s technology sector.
The Business Case
For HR professionals and managers, investing in CTAL-TAE training offers a significant return on investment. Certified professionals can enhance the quality and reliability of software products, reducing the time and cost associated with manual testing. This leads to faster time-to-market for new products and services. Moreover, having a certified team can improve company reputation, attract new clients, and open doors to more business opportunities. The skills acquired through this course enable participants to implement efficient testing frameworks, ultimately contributing to the organization’s bottom line.
Course Objectives
- Understand the fundamentals of test automation and its application in the software development lifecycle.
- Learn to design and develop scalable and maintainable test automation frameworks.
- Gain proficiency in using tools and technologies associated with test automation.
- Prepare for the CTAL-TAE certification exam with comprehensive study materials and practice tests.
- Develop the ability to evaluate and improve existing test automation processes.
Syllabus
Module 1: Introduction to Test Automation
Explore the basics of test automation, its significance, and the different types of testing applicable to automation. Understand the role of a test automation engineer within a project team.
Module 2: Design for Test Automation
Learn how to design effective test automation architectures and frameworks. This module covers design patterns, best practices, and the selection of appropriate tools and technologies.
Module 3: Development of Test Automation Solutions
Gain hands-on experience in developing test scripts and solutions. This includes coding standards, script maintenance, and ensuring the robustness of automated tests.
Module 4: Deployment and Execution
Understand the deployment of test automation solutions in different environments. Learn about continuous integration and continuous deployment (CI/CD) pipelines and their role in automation.
Module 5: Improving Test Automation
Focus on the optimization and scaling of test automation solutions. This includes troubleshooting, performance tuning, and leveraging analytics for improvement.
Methodology
Our course employs an interactive approach combining lectures, hands-on labs, and group discussions. Participants will engage in real-world projects, allowing them to apply theoretical knowledge in practical scenarios. Continuous feedback and support from experienced instructors ensure an effective learning journey, tailored to the participants’ needs.
Who Should Attend
This course is ideal for software testers, test managers, and quality assurance professionals who wish to advance their careers in test automation. It is also beneficial for software developers and IT professionals seeking to expand their expertise in automated testing and contribute more effectively to their teams.
FAQs
What is the duration of the course?
The course is designed to be completed in four weeks, with a combination of live sessions and self-paced learning.
Are there any prerequisites?
Participants should have a basic understanding of software testing principles and some experience in software development or testing.
What materials will be provided?
Comprehensive study materials, access to an online learning portal, and practice exams are included in the course fee.